Tanji
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Tanji is a fishing village of 15,000 people on the western cost of the Gambia. In Tanji you can view the whole industry from making boats and nets, catching fish, salting, smoking and freezing fish.
Ghana Town
Village
Photo: Jolle,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ghana Town is a small coastal fishing town in western Gambia. It is located in Kombo North/Saint Mary District in the Western Division. As of 2024, it had an estimated population of approximately 1,500. Ghana Town is situated 4 km northeast of Tanji Lower Basic School.
